If x+y= 15, y+z=25, and x+z=20, what is the arithmetic mean of x,y, and z
1 answer:
X + y = 15
Rearrange this to isolate for x.
x = 15 - y
x + z = 20
Rearrange this to isolate for x also.
x = 20 - z
Since they are both equal to x, that means they are equal to each other (x = x)
Set them equal to each other.
15 - y = 20 - z
Now, isolate for y.
y = 15 - 20 + z
Now, use y + z = 25 and isolate for y.
y = 25 - z
Since they are both equal to y, we set them equal to each other.
15 - 20 + z = 25 - z
Solve for z
z + z = 25 - 15 + 20
2z = 30
2z/2 = 30/z
z = 15
Now you can plug the value for z into the other equations to find y and x.
x + z = 20
x +15 = 20
x = 20-15
x = 5
y + z = 25
y + 15 = 25
y = 25 - 15
y = 10
